FLO London | Chelsea Barracks Spring Fair returns for its third edition (2024)

Adjacent to this year’s Chelsea Flower Show is Chelsea Barracks, simultaneously hosting a spring fair for visitors to the area with the opportunity to see the development of this 12.8-acre site previously out of public reach for 150 years.

The third edition of their spring fair is presented in partnership with House and Garden magazine and promises to be a wonderful celebration of Spring and will feature the following:

The Artisans’ Market

Visitors will see a diverse selection of independent brands offering unique crafts and gourmet treats. House & Garden has curated 15 stands run by their favourite independent decorative, homeware, beauty and jewellery brands, including Sharland England by Louise Roe and Collins & Green Art.

Specialist Reader Seminars

Exclusive workshops and discussions will be held at The Campaner (a Catalonian restaurant), including Interior Design Clinics and conversations with industry luminaries. The seminars are £15 per person.

  • 22 May Design Clinic (2 - 4pm): Network with 10 design professionals from The List by House & Garden and enjoy an exclusive opportunity to pose questions to the experts.

  • 23 May Garrison Chapel (4.30 to 5.30pm): Join interiors guru and broadcaster Louise Roe in conversation with stylist Noni Ware.

  • 24 May Garden Clinic (5 to 6pm): House & Garden editor Clare Foster discusses all things horticultural with Chelsea Gold Medallists Jo Thompson and Tom Massey.

Modern Masters

An outdoor programme of contemporary art curated by New Public is launching on the 13th May entitled “Modern Masters”, (through till October 2024) featuring Dale Chihuly, an American glass artist and entrepreneur. He is well known in the field of blown glass and Londoners will be most familiar with his Rotunda Chandlier which hangs in the Victoria & Albert Museum. “Chihuly at Chelsea Barracks” will showcase his iconic sculptures throughout the Barracks’ public grounds.

Fingers crossed for some sunshine and it should prove to be a lovely day out.

Date: 22 - 25 May 2024. Location: Chelsea Barracks, Chelsea Barracks, Belgravia, London, SW1W 8BW. Entrance: Free. Click here to book tickets for events.
